John Curtis Christian waltzed into their contest on Wednesday with four straight wins... but they left with five. They were the clear victor by a 3-0 margin over the Crescent City Christian Pioneers. The Patriots have seen this before: they got the W the last time they saw the Pioneers, too.
John Curtis Christian walked away with the win (and looked especially good in the second set). The final score came out to 25-20, 25-15, 25-16.
John Curtis Christian was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 13 a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least five aces in five consecutive matches.
John Curtis Christian's victory was their fifth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 30-7. As for Crescent City Christian, they moved to 19-9 with that defeat, which also ended their seven-game winning streak.
